Congress expels 13 rebel members in Assam

The Congress has expelled 13 members in Assam, including a sitting MLA, who had filed their nominations as independents following denial of party tickets to them for the forthcoming assembly polls.

The rebels have been expelled for six years for anti-party activities; Assam Pradesh Congress committee media cell chairman I P Hazarika said in Guwahati on Monday.

Those expelled include Karimganj MLA Siddique Ahmed, controversial party MP and lottery baron Mani Kumar Subba's brother Sanjay Raj Subba contesting from Naoboicha, Samsul Islam from Hailakandi, Kaliram Deka (Morigaon), Swapan Kumar (Lumding), Tusheswar Neog (Golaghat), Osiram Doley (Majuli), Umesh Gogoi (Thowra), Samujjal Prasad Barua (Sonari), Nilosh Hazarika (Bihpuria), Paramananda Doley (Chabua), Durgeshwar Tanti (Dhemaji) and Pradeep Buragohain (Nahorkotia).

Hazarika said the party would not tolerate any anti-party activities and had therefore decided to expel members who were contesting as independents.
